Key Learnings
- Learn how to use the relationships between InfraWorks and Civil 3D to better align model content
- Learn how to create InfraWorks models using Model Builder, Revit, SketchUp, photogrammetry, and terrain overlays, and use them in the cloud
- Learn how to enhance models by adding buildings, equipment, roads, fences, signs, people, and more
- Learn from presentation materials such as storyboards, images, and VR models

- Don JosephsonDon has been in the construction industry in the Pacific Northwest for over 17 years. He graduated with a B.S. in Construction Management from Brigham Young University-Idaho in 2007. He spent 7 years as a Project Engineer/BIM Coordinator where he learned the ins and outs of many types of commercial construction. He is in his 11th year as Director of Construction Technology for Howard S. Wright a Balfour Beatty Company. Through the course of his career, Don has managed and helped manage the coordination process for over $3 Billion worth of construction comprising more than 35 buildings. Don is passionate about the benefits that come from proper planning and strives to use the appropriate tools to best communicate that plan to others. There are few things as satisfying as digging into a new project, identifying issues followed by solutions and then seeing those solutions successfully executed. BIM/VDC will continue to shape the future of construction. Don is a dedicated family man and has a beautiful wife and 5 children. His hobby is spending time with them doing outdoor activities, board games, cooking and camping. Don is also very active in his church and community. Don is a Revit Architecture Certified Professional
